European Parliament delays vote on crypto assets bill over proof-of-work debate (via the_postman_)

Debate over proof-of-work mining, especially Bitcoin’s energy usage, has delayed votes on Europe’s long-awaited crypto markets directive.

Initially scheduled for February 28, the rapporteur in charge of the votes has put them off indefinitely as a leak of amendments that many saw as PoW bans generated public outcry.The parliament of the European Union has delayed a key vote on its long-awaited cryptocurrency market regulation in response to outrage from the crypto world.

However, Stefan Berger, chairman of the Economics Committee and rapporteur in charge of that vote, has postponed it, Berger's office told The Block today. A source close to negotiations over the directive told The Block that the primary point of contention was late-stage changes that some interpreted as bans on proof-of-work networks, primarily out of concerns over their energy usage.
